Installing the Water Supply and Connecting to a Water Source

In this section, I will guide you through the process of setting up the water supply for your pressure washing trailer and connecting it to a water source. This is an important step as it ensures a consistent flow of water for effective cleaning.

The first step is to determine the water source for your pressure washer trailer. You have several options, such as connecting to a garden hose, using a water tank, or tapping into a water supply line. Choose the option that best suits your needs and availability of resources.

[content-egg-block template=offers_list limit=1 offset=2]

Once you have chosen the water source, you need to establish a reliable connection. If you are using a garden hose, make sure it is long enough to reach the pressure washer trailer and connect it securely to the water inlet. Use a hose clamp to ensure a tight fit and prevent any leaks.

If you are using a water tank, ensure that it is properly installed on your trailer. Position it securely and use fittings and hoses to connect it to the pressure washer’s water inlet. Make sure the tank is filled with clean water before connecting it to the trailer.

Water Source Connection Method
Garden Hose Securely connect the hose to the water inlet using a hose clamp.
Water Tank Install the tank on the trailer and connect it to the water inlet using fittings and hoses.
Water Supply Line Tap into a nearby water supply line and connect it to the trailer using appropriate plumbing connections.

Once the water source is connected, it is important to test the system for any leaks. Turn on the water supply and check for any visible leaks around the connections. If you notice any leaks, tighten the connections or replace any faulty fittings immediately to prevent water wastage and ensure efficient operation.

With the water supply properly installed and connected, you are now ready to use your pressure washer trailer effectively. Make sure to follow all safety guidelines and operating instructions provided by the manufacturer for a smooth and successful cleaning experience.

Pressure Control Valve Adjustment

An important component of the pressure regulation system is the pressure control valve. This valve allows you to adjust the pressure to the desired level for your specific cleaning tasks. To begin, locate the pressure control valve, usually found near the pump or along the waterline. Make sure the system is powered off before adjusting the valve.

Begin by turning the valve counterclockwise to decrease the pressure or clockwise to increase it. It is crucial to make small adjustments and test the pressure output after each adjustment to avoid damaging the system or causing excessive wear on the equipment. Keep in mind that different cleaning tasks may require different pressure settings, so it is advisable to begin with a lower pressure and gradually increase if necessary.

Pressure Gauge Installation

Installing a pressure gauge in your pressure regulation system provides an accurate measurement of the pressure output. This allows you to monitor and adjust the pressure accordingly. To install the pressure gauge, locate a suitable location on the system where it can be easily visible and accessible.

Once you have found the appropriate location, ensure that the system is powered off. Connect the pressure gauge to the designated port, typically found on the pressure control valve or pump. Use a wrench to securely tighten the connection, ensuring no leaks are present. Once the gauge is properly installed, you can power on the system and monitor the pressure output.

Regular Maintenance and Troubleshooting Tips for Your High-Pressure Cleaning Setup

As an experienced user of high-pressure cleaning systems, I have learned the importance of regular maintenance and troubleshooting to keep your equipment running smoothly and efficiently. In this section, I will share some valuable tips and advice based on my own first-hand experiences.

Preventive Maintenance:

One key aspect of maintaining your high-pressure cleaning setup is to regularly inspect and clean the various components. Keeping an eye on the hoses, nozzles, and fittings for any signs of wear or damage can help prevent leaks and unexpected breakdowns. Additionally, ensuring proper lubrication of the pump and engine parts is crucial for optimal performance and longevity. Regularly checking and replacing filters is also vital to prevent clogs and maintain consistent water flow.

[content-egg-block template=offers_list limit=1 offset=6]

Tip: Be mindful of using high-quality detergents and additives that are compatible with your system to avoid clogs and damage to internal components.

Troubleshooting:

Even with regular maintenance, there may be times when your high-pressure cleaning setup encounters issues. Here are some common problems and their possible solutions:

1. Loss of Pressure: If you notice a decrease in water pressure, check the inlet and outlet filters for any clogs. Clean or replace them as necessary. Additionally, inspect the nozzle for any blockages or wear that may affect the spray pattern.

2. Excessive Vibrations: Excessive vibrations during operation can indicate an unbalanced pump or engine. Check and adjust the levels of both components, ensuring they are securely mounted and aligned.

3. Overheating: If your equipment is overheating, it may be due to a lack of water flow or a malfunctioning thermal relief valve. Ensure that the water supply is sufficient and the valve is working correctly.

Tip: Refer to the manufacturer’s manual for troubleshooting specific to your high-pressure cleaning system.

By implementing these regular maintenance practices and having effective troubleshooting strategies in place, you can maximize the performance and lifespan of your high-pressure cleaning setup. Remember, a well-maintained system will not only save you time and money in repairs but also ensure optimal cleaning results for your various applications.
